The Telecommunications technician must take of gathering equipment, supplies, materials, and tools. The professional will be responsible for performing detailed equipment engineering for any new networks. They have to install, configure and obtain all the necessary management approvals. The professional will provide technical assistance to network projects, Telecommunication systems and process.
Educational QualificationsThe candidate must have a bachelor’s degree in Telecommunications, Electronics & Electrical, Computer Science, Information Technology or any related field. The individual must have the excellent technical knowledge to handle any issues. Some employers will look for candidates with prior work experience or a master’s degree.
Career OutlookThe prospects for Telecommunication Implementation Network Technician seems to be going on a steady pace. There is supposed to be growth in the job opportunities and candidates with little or more experience are the ones who have bright chances of getting hired.
